WebOther treatment options for bipolar disorder can include: Electroconvulsive therapy (ECT). WebBipolar disorder is a recurrent illness, meaning that it can occur throughout one’s lifetime. So the best treatment is usually long-term and involves acute management (to manage current symptoms), continuation therapy (to prevent return of symptoms from the same episode) and maintenance (to prevent a recurrence of symptoms in the future).

Quit drinking or using recreational drugs.One of the biggest concerns with … Ver mais Web23 de fev. de 2024 · Things you can say that might help: “Bipolar disorder is a real illness, like diabetes. It requires medical treatment.” “You're not to blame for bipolar disorder. You didn't cause it. It's not your fault.” “You can feel better. There are many treatments that can help.” “When bipolar disorder isn't treated, it usually gets worse.”
